Ryan Gattis writes fiction set in and around Los Angeles, often focusing on crime, gangs, and the people caught up in the justice system. His breakout novel All Involved (2015) told the story of the 1992 L.A. riots through the voices of gang members, firefighters, nurses, and ordinary residents. The book was praised for its raw, ground-level perspective on a chaotic six days in the city’s history.
Gattis followed up with Safe (2017) and The System (2020), which looked at the criminal justice system from multiple angles. His earlier books, including the surreal Kung Fu High School (2005), showed a more experimental side. He has also written shorter works in the Big Drop series.
